As a pet parent, the thought of your little furball thriving gives you warm fuzzies. But what goes into feeding them just right? It all begins with choosing the perfect puppy food, especially for a Shih Tzu puppy. Let's dive into the world of high-protein, low-fat, and easy-to-digest kibble and how to pick what's best for your pup.
First things first, every puppy has a unique dietary landscape. Young pups, like Shih Tzus, require a nutritionally balanced diet to support their rapid growth and development. It's like giving them the building blocks for a strong and healthy future!
Not all kibble is created equal, my friends. High-quality brands have stricter standards and better quality control. Think of it like a gourmet meal versus a fast food dinner—it's the difference in how you want your pup to feel after a meal!
Take a good look at the ingredients list. A Shih Tzu puppy kibble might feature chicken, rice, and oatmeal—free from artificial additives. It's like the gourmet dish for your furry friend!
It's not just about the ingredients; it's about how they're paired. Chicken and rice in a Shih Tzu puppy kibble? A match made in heaven for protein and carbs. Add a touch of oatmeal, and you've got a recipe for stable blood sugar levels, just like a good breakfast should be.
Just like us, dogs are different. A Shih Tzu puppy kibble is tailored for their specific needs, ensuring they get the nutrients they need as they grow.
Keep that kibble in top shape. Store it in a cool, dry place, away from sunlight. It's like giving your puppy's food a spa day to keep it fresh and flavorful!
Some pups prefer wet food over dry; others may have a picky appetite. Finding what your Shih Tzu loves is like discovering their favorite snack—it's a game-changer for mealtime!
Chocolates, alcohol, caffeine—these are no-nos for our furry friends. Keep the human food out of reach and safe from prying paws!
Changing kibble brands often can upset your pup's stomach. Stick with what works, like a good friend you can count on!
Does your Shih Tzu love their kibble? Do they digest it well? Are there any adverse reactions? It's like being a detective at mealtimes!
Always have fresh water available for your pup. After all, it's the elixir of life!
Avoid piling food in front of your pup. It's like teaching them about portion control before they even know what that means!
Chat with your vet for expert advice. They're like the chefs of the veterinary world, suggesting the perfect dish for your Shih Tzu.
Outdated kibble? Run away, fast! It's like serving yesterday's leftovers to your best friend.
Shih Tzu puppy kibble is specially formulated to cater to their needs. It's all about the balance—ingredients, brand, and personalization. Combine this with proper storage, diet habits, and portion control, and you've got a recipe for a happy and healthy Shih Tzu.
